
Spelunk, plunder, and pickaxe in Lost Caves, A 2D collect-a-thon all about exploration and treasure hunting! Venture through 4 expansive labyrinthine levels to find over 80 unique treasures to amass your wealth, and use your trusty pickaxe to defeat anything in your way!

Great little cave crawling adventure! Does everything you'd want in a game like this. Tight controls, lovely pixel art, and some perfect fonky chiptunes to back them up. It has a couple rough edges (biggest complaint is you can't remap controls in the version I played, but apparently this is still being worked on), but the gameplay is solid in every way that counts. Recommended!

Lost Caves is a fun little platformer that provides a great sense of exploration and adventure. The game doesn't hold your hand, and the design is so intuitive that it is able to show rather than tell. It'll make you crave exploration through discovering new areas, enemies, and that sweet, sweet loot. This game gets a big thumbs up from me, and I look forward to seeing what this developer does in the future, whether it be adding content for this game or making something new!
Really nice game, couldn't ask for more under a euro. I missed the option for keybinding, because I was playing on keyboard, not on controller, and the key bindings were super weird. I had to hit every key on my keyboard to figure out which key is bound to something. Also a separate slider for music would have been nice. Other than that super neat game, really liked the visuals, sound, music and level design. Hitting the enemies is also a lot of fun, I could feel the impact. For this price, I can only recommend this game.

The game is fun. I really enjoyed it for the little bit that I have played it for. Soundtrack and art style are really well done. The only thing I didn't like is the lack of audio settings. It would have been great if there were separate music and audio sliders because the music was a bit too loud for me. Other than that, it's a great little platformer, especially if you like retro styled games.
